Dungeons & Dragons Online (DDO) is a unique MMORPG with a dedicated fanbase, but whether it's "good" depends on what you're looking for. Heres a breakdown of its strengths and weaknesses: Pros: Faithful to D&D Mechanics Uses Dungeons & Dragons 3.5 Edition rules (with some adaptations), including classes, feats, skills, and turn-based-inspired combat. Great Dungeon Design Focuses on hand-crafted, puzzle-heavy dungeons with traps, secret doors, and non-linear paths, making exploration rewarding. Active Combat Unlike tab-targeting MMOs, DDO has real-time action with dodging, blocking, and manual aiming for spells/attacks. Strong Build Variety Multiclassing and deep customization allow for creative character builds (e.g., Rogue/Wizard hybrids). Free-to-Play Friendly You can access a lot of content without paying, though some expansions/races/classes require purchase. Niche but Loyal Community Smaller than big MMOs, but helpful and welcoming to newcomers. Cons: Dated Graphics & UI Released in 2006, the visuals and interface feel old compared to modern MMOs. Steep Learning Curve The D&D ruleset and complex mechanics can overwhelm beginners. Grindy Progression Endgame relies heavily on re-running dungeons for loot and favor (currency). Paywall for Key Content While F2P is viable, major expansions (like Menace of the Underdark) must be bought. Small Population Servers arent packed, so grouping can be tough outside peak times. Verdict: If you love D&D, exploration-heavy dungeons, and deep character builds, DDO is a hidden gem worth trying. If you prefer polished graphics, fast-paced combat, or massive open worlds, you might find it clunky. Try it for freeits one of the few MMOs where playing solo or in small groups feels rewarding. The early game gives a good taste of its strengths.
